Output 96fb1a5cab66233b9348131e632a4790f40072b68524133a8150cecf16332b00:1

value
101414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a7df5bb3103bec336efcca650cc78a708ad8c08 OP_EQUAL
address
3Fmtsw1h6Bzjujcvmqe38rAf35shp1RSUQ
transaction
96fb1a5cab66233b9348131e632a4790f40072b68524133a8150cecf16332b00
confirmations
113408
spent
true